Hi,
I will have to check exactly the changes and test these bugs. At the moment i dont have HW B. but what i found now:
Change the connector and button aligned order on the back panel.
New chipset solution
Change Software architecture for New UI
Phase in New GUI
Remove the ability to read device log on web management directly, but maintain Syslog and E-mail log support.
Remove Application Rule
